Gemuadrken, recipe for mushrooms please? Put cheese/spinach on and bake, or what?
Looks like an awesome snack, and could be a basically PSMF meal if I use my ff shredded mozz me thinks.
-
03-01-2013, 02:12 PM #5270
I used 4x large portabellas (i cut out the stems), and then seasoned them with salt, pepper, and garlic pepper, then with some spinache that I chopped up
I chopped up some "Cabot Catamount hills" cheese from Whole Foods which had an awesome flavor, texture, and was reasonably priced, and put that on top (about 3.5 oz of it), and then I drizzled about 1 tbsp of olive oil over them (.25 tbsp per)
It looked like this: before i put them in the oven
I put it in the oven at 325 until the mushrooms were cooked, and then put it up to 425 for a few minutes to try and give the cheese some color (which didnt happen)
If that makes sense.
563 calories
42g fat
22g carb
35g protein
